Evanston Golf Club is an 18-hole golf course in Skokie, IL with a par of 70. It offers 7 tee sets: black (6,839 yards, slope 136, rating 73.4), blue (6,613 yards, slope 134, rating 72.3), member (6,464 yards, slope 131, rating 71.7), green (6,261 yards, slope 129, rating 70.8), green/silver (6,009 yards, slope 126, rating 69.6), silver (5,723 yards, slope 123, rating 68.3), white (5,401 yards, slope 119, rating 66.8). The hardest hole is #2, a par 4 playing 440 yards from the first tee.

Scorecard
| Hole | 1 | 2 | 3 | 4 | 5 | 6 | 7 | 8 | 9 | Out | 10 | 11 | 12 | 13 | 14 | 15 | 16 | 17 | 18 | In | Tot |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Par | 4 | 4 | 4 | 3 | 4 | 5 | 3 | 4 | 4 | 35 | 4 | 4 | 3 | 5 | 4 | 4 | 4 | 3 | 4 | 35 | 70 |
| HCP | 5 | 1 | 7 | 17 | 13 | 3 | 15 | 11 | 9 | 12 | 2 | 18 | 6 | 10 | 14 | 8 | 16 | 4 | |||
| black | 445 | 445 | 451 | 202 | 322 | 503 | 157 | 405 | 441 | 3371 | 377 | 452 | 196 | 550 | 364 | 399 | 437 | 220 | 473 | 3468 | 6839 |
| blue | 424 | 440 | 438 | 197 | 318 | 497 | 152 | 384 | 416 | 3266 | 371 | 446 | 190 | 532 | 341 | 389 | 431 | 203 | 444 | 3347 | 6613 |
| member | 424 | 428 | 420 | 181 | 301 | 497 | 127 | 384 | 416 | 3178 | 371 | 429 | 173 | 532 | 341 | 401 | 414 | 191 | 434 | 3286 | 6464 |
| green | 417 | 428 | 420 | 181 | 301 | 457 | 135 | 356 | 373 | 3068 | 350 | 429 | 173 | 518 | 313 | 371 | 414 | 191 | 434 | 3193 | 6261 |
| green/silver | 399 | 400 | 406 | 181 | 301 | 457 | 135 | 356 | 373 | 3008 | 350 | 369 | 173 | 443 | 313 | 371 | 374 | 191 | 417 | 3001 | 6009 |
| silver | 399 | 400 | 406 | 151 | 295 | 452 | 127 | 284 | 353 | 2867 | 322 | 369 | 165 | 443 | 278 | 322 | 374 | 166 | 417 | 2856 | 5723 |
| white | 394 | 397 | 363 | 148 | 236 | 435 | 122 | 279 | 306 | 2680 | 316 | 364 | 108 | 437 | 274 | 318 | 370 | 124 | 410 | 2721 | 5401 |
